What Does It Mean To Be Given A Challenge Coin

Bullet Points

Challenge coins have a long and fascinating history, dating back to ancient Rome, where soldiers were awarded special coins for their bravery and valor in battle. Over time, the use of coins as tokens of recognition has spread to many other cultures and organizations.

Today, challenge coins are commonly used in the military, law enforcement, and other organizations to recognize service, achievement, and commitment.

The Meaning Behind Challenge Coins

Challenge coins have long been a symbol of camaraderie and unity among members of a group or organization. A challenge coin typically contains a unique design, logo, or motto specific to the group or organization it represents. The coin serves as a reminder of the bond shared by members of a group and the values they uphold.

Challenge coins are usually given to members of a group in recognition of their service or dedication. They are often presented during special ceremonies or occasions, such as promotions or retirements. Challenge coins are also often given to members of a unit or organization who have gone above and beyond the call of duty.

Receiving a challenge coin is a sign of appreciation and respect from the group or organization, and it is a reminder of the commitment and dedication to the unit. Receiving a challenge coin is a great honor and a sign of recognition for one’s service and commitment. Receiving a challenge coin can also be an emotional experience, especially for those who have served in the military or law enforcement.

The coin represents a physical manifestation of the sacrifices that have been made and the hardships that have been endured in service to the organization and the country.

Etiquette of Giving and Receiving Challenge Coins

There are certain customs and traditions associated with giving and receiving challenge coins. These vary depending on the organization and the situation, but there are some general guidelines that should be followed. 

When giving a challenge coin, it is important to present it with respect and reverence. The coin should be handed to the recipient with a firm handshake and a clear statement of why it is being given.

The recipient should be thanked for their service and commitment and should be told that they are a valued member of the organization. When receiving a challenge coin, it is important to accept it with gratitude and respect.

The Role of Challenge Coins in Modern Society”

One of the most prominent roles of challenge coins in modern society is their ability to foster a sense of community and belonging. It can strengthen the sense of community among members but also serves as a reminder of their duty to the organization and the public they serve.

Challenge coins also serve as a tool to build morale and motivation within an organization. When a member receives a challenge coin for their efforts, it not only boosts their morale but also motivates them to continue performing at a high level. This, in turn, contributes to the overall success of the organization.

In addition to boosting morale, challenge coins also promote healthy competition within an organization. The tradition of coin checks or challenges is a popular way of using challenge coins to promote camaraderie among members, friendly competition adds to the sense of community and helps members get to know each other better.

While challenge coins have traditionally been associated with the military and law enforcement, they are now being used in a variety of settings.

Many businesses, clubs, and organizations have adopted the tradition of challenge coins as a way to recognize and reward employees or members who have gone above and beyond in their duties. Some groups even use challenge coins as a way to raise money for charitable causes or to promote their organization.

Whether it is presented in recognition of a specific achievement or simply as a symbol of membership in a particular group or organization, a challenge coin carries with it a rich history and tradition that makes it a cherished and valuable item for those who receive it.
